Meet Cairo (aka Big Dog) 🐾 Looking for a loyal sidekick, adventure buddy, and professional Velcro dog all rolled into one handsome package? Meet Cairo — a 4-year-old neutered Belgian Malinois with a big personality and an even bigger heart. Cairo’s story started rough. He was found wandering the Texas countryside as a stray, severely underweight at just 50 pounds and too weak to stand. Today, this resilient boy has transformed into a healthy, happy 65-pound goofball who’s ready to leave the dusty roads behind and finally find his forever home. At first, Cairo can be a little reserved and cautious while he figures you out. But once you earn his trust, you’re officially his person. From that moment on, he becomes the ultimate Velcro dog — following you from room to room, leaning against your legs, attempting to climb into your lap like he’s a tiny puppy, and giving dramatic sighs if you leave him alone for too long. Like a true Belgian Malinois, Cairo is whip-smart, intensely loyal, and always ready for his next job — even if he occasionally invents one for himself. He’s the kind of dog who wants to be part of everything you do, whether that’s hiking a trail, tossing a ball in the backyard, or supervising your every move around the house. Malinois fans know the breed’s magic: fierce devotion, incredible intelligence, and a bond that runs deep. Cairo brings all of that… plus a goofy streak that keeps life entertaining. He’s equal parts loyal protector and oversized clown. One minute he’s on neighborhood watch duty with his serious “I’ve got this handled” bark, and the next he’s prancing around with a toy in his mouth like the happiest dork alive. He’s expressive, hilarious, affectionate, and absolutely full of personality. The Good Stuff: Crate trained and happy to relax in his kennel Mostly house trained and learning routines quickly Dog-friendly with excellent play energy Smart, eager to learn, and highly trainable Loves tug, fetch, puzzle toys, and interactive games A Few Honest Notes: Cairo is looking for an adult-only home or one with older, respectful teens. Young children make him nervous, and he does best when his space and boundaries are respected. He also cannot live with cats, chickens, or other small animals due to his prey drive. What Cairo Needs: Cairo is looking for someone who appreciates everything that makes a Belgian Malinois special — intelligence, athleticism, loyalty, and that deep desire to be connected to their person. He’s not a “sit around all day” kind of dog; he thrives when he has structure, activity, and a job to do, even if that job is mastering puzzle toys or joining you on outdoor adventures. Give this boy guidance, consistency, and plenty of love, and you’ll get the kind of once-in-a-lifetime dog people rave about. In return, Cairo will give you unwavering loyalty, endless laughs, and the kind of deep bond Belgian Malinois are famous for. If you’re ready for a smart, protective, hilariously clingy best friend, Cairo may be your perfect match. Please visit http://aarf-tn.com/adopt/adoption-app/ to apply. Mali is an energetic, intelligent girl who lights up when she has a job to do and a person to love. This 3.5 year old, 55 pound Belgian Malinois is active, athletic, and happiest when she is moving, learning, or exploring the world alongside her favorite human. Mali loves jogging, hiking, walking, and turning everyday outings into adventures, especially if squirrels are involved. She is incredibly smart and knows an impressive list of commands including sit, down, stay, come, heel, place, wait at doors, find it, and going into her crate. She truly enjoys working and learning, although she is not a candidate for service dog work. Training for fun, enrichment, and bonding is where she shines. She can be a bit reserved with new people at first, but with treats, patience, and a walk, she warms up nicely. She is very clean in the house, fully crate trained, and when she is crated she primarily naps while her owner is gone. Mali loads easily into the car and walks beautifully on leash when given clear direction. She bonds deeply with her person and wants nothing more than to be someone’s loyal, devoted best girl. Mali would do best in an active, dog-savvy home that understands the breed and enjoys regular exercise and training. A quieter household without cats or young children and with a confident, similar-sized male dog companion would likely be the best fit. (All About Rescue and Fixin' Inc.) http://aarf-tn.com/ is a non-profit, 501(c)(3) no kill animal rescue organization located in the Upper Cumberland area of Tennessee. A.A.R.F. is comprised of unpaid volunteers and survives only on public donations. Thank you for thinking adoption first! Prior to adoption, all canines and felines are spayed or neutered, have received their age appropriate vaccinations, have been de-wormed for common parasites, and have received treatment for prevention of fleas and ticks. All canines over the age of 6 months have been tested for heartworm. All canines are put on heartworm prevention as soon as possible - this means dogs as soon as they are tested negative. Puppies are put on prevention immediately. All felines, regardless of age, have been tested for Feline Leukemia/FIV. Each animal receives a health check by a licensed veterinarian prior to adoption. Anything else found will be treated by our organization prior to adoption. June 15, 2026, 1:26 pm
